🔢 Part 1: Basic Decimal Addition and Subtraction

Instructions: Solve these decimal problems. Remember to line up the decimal points!

1. Add these decimals:

a) 2.3 + 4.5 = _______

b) 1.6 + 3.2 = _______

c) 5.4 + 2.1 = _______

2. Subtract these decimals:

a) 8.7 - 3.4 = _______

b) 6.9 - 2.5 = _______

c) 9.8 - 4.6 = _______

3. Circle the correct answer for 3.25 + 1.42:

4.67

4.76

3.67

5.67

💰 Part 2: Money Problems

Instructions: Solve these real-life money problems using decimal addition and subtraction.

4. Sarah bought a sandwich for $4.75 and a drink for $2.30. How much did she spend in total?

Answer: $ _______

5. Tom had $15.60. He bought a book for $8.25. How much money does he have left?

Answer: $ _______

6. Which items can you buy with exactly $10.00? (Check all that apply)

Pencil case $3.50 + Ruler $1.25 + Eraser $0.75 + Notebook $4.50

Lunch $6.80 + Juice $3.20

Magazine $4.95 + Chocolate $2.15 + Gum $1.90

Bus ticket $2.40 + Snack $3.60 + Water $4.00

📏 Part 3: Measurement Problems

Instructions: Solve these measurement problems involving metres and centimetres.

7. A rope is 3.45 metres long. Another rope is 2.78 metres long. What is the total length when joined together?

Answer: _______ metres

8. A piece of wood was 5.60 metres long. After cutting off 1.85 metres, how long is the remaining piece?

Answer: _______ metres

9. Fill in the missing numbers:

a) 4.2 + _____ = 7.8

b) _____ - 2.6 = 3.9

c) 8.5 - _____ = 5.7
